Abstract

Background: The World Health Organization (WHO) recommends that all pregnant women receive a daily supplement containing 30–60 mg of elemental iron and 400 µg of folic acid throughout pregnancy as part of antenatal care (ANC). The 2010 Indonesian Basic Health Research (Riskesdas) reported that 80.7% of women aged 10–59 years received or purchased iron (Fe) tablets. However, 19.3% of pregnant women did not consume iron tablets, and only 18.0% consumed 90 tablets or more during pregnancy. This study aimed to analyze the factors influencing pregnant women's adherence to iron (Fe) tablet consumption. Methods: This quantitative study involved a population and sample of 28 pregnant women, selected using a total sampling technique. Data were analyzed using bivariate correlation tests with a significance level of p < 0.05. The study was conducted at Rasana'e Timur Public Health Center, Bima City, West Nusa Tenggara Province, Indonesia, in 2024. Results: The results showed that parity (p < 0.04), knowledge (p < 0.03), and motivation (p < 0.04) were significantly associated with pregnant women's adherence to iron (Fe) tablet consumption. In contrast, age (p > 0.20), education (p > 0.30), and occupation (p > 0.10) were not significantly associated with adherence to iron (Fe) tablet consumption. Conclusion: Parity, knowledge, and motivation significantly influence pregnant women's adherence to iron (Fe) tablet consumption. Therefore, health education should be strengthened to improve awareness of the importance of consuming iron supplements during pregnancy.
